Multiple Choice

What type of specimen is required for a fasting blood glucose test?

Explanation:
A fasting blood glucose test specifically requires a whole blood or serum sample after a period of fasting, typically 8 to 12 hours. This fasting period is essential because it allows for the measurement of blood glucose without the influence of recent food intake, which could affect the accuracy of the test results. When a patient is fasting, their body has utilized most of the available glucose, and this provides a clearer baseline measurement of insulin response and carbohydrate metabolism. The test is primarily used to screen for diabetes or monitor glucose levels in individuals diagnosed with diabetes. The other options do not fulfill the requirements of a fasting blood glucose test. A urine sample is not appropriate because glucose levels in urine may not accurately reflect blood glucose levels and can vary based on hydration and renal function. A citrate plasma sample is typically used for coagulation studies, not glucose testing. A venous blood sample taken at any time, irrespective of fasting, would not provide the specific fasting information needed to make an accurate assessment of glucose metabolism. Thus, the requirement for fasting and the type of specimen needed emphasizes the importance of the correct sample preparation in obtaining reliable test results.

What’s the Deal with Fasting Blood Glucose Tests?

You might be wondering, why is fasting so crucial for this test? To put it simply, fasting—typically defined as a stretch of 8 to 12 hours without food—provides a baseline that allows healthcare providers to accurately assess how well your body is managing glucose, the sugar in your blood.

When you abstain from food, your body draws on its stored glucose, giving you a clearer idea of your insulin response and carbohydrate metabolism at rest. This process helps identify potential issues with blood sugar levels and insulin sensitivity, making it a key component in diabetes screening.

Specimen Selection: The Heart of the Matter

Now, let’s talk specifics. For this test, the correct answer is B: Whole blood or serum sample after fasting. Other options, like urine samples or even citrate plasma samples, just don’t cut it for this particular test.

  • Urine samples? Not the best option, because glucose concentration there can sway based on your hydration or renal function—definitely not a reliable measure.

  • Citrate plasma samples are usually meant for coagulation studies; glucose testing isn’t their jam.

  • And taking a venous blood sample at any time won’t provide the necessary fasting context to make accurate assessments. It’s like trying to read a novel by only flipping to random pages—you’re never really going to get the complete story!
